    New iPhone/iPod Patent - This is Way Cool Stuff

    Appleiphonepatent200806021A new, all-encompassing, iPhone/iPod patent surfaced today, and it gives some interesting insights into Apple's vision of the future.  Some of the more interesting bits:

    • Instant messaging integration.  This has the real possibility of being the de facto standard to a Twitter-type conversation cloud.
    • Flash.  They seem determined to get this, and some very interesting communication capabilities arise in the browser when you can run Flash.
    • Voice-activated commands and voice capture.  Aside from being extremely cool, a built-in voice recognition system would just be even cooler.  Voice becomes the new interface.
    • A built-in front-facing camera for video conferencing.  Apple will make this work.  They will make lots of money doing it as well.
    • Velocity and acceleration detectors.  They're turning it into a Wii controller!  You can do some cool things with a Wii remote, and this type of user input really blurs the line between the physical and the virtual.
    • GPS.  No self-respecting mobile device should be without it.

    It's telling that Steve Jobs had himself listed as the first inventor on this patent.  If it is built, this will be the ultimate communications device.  No, it will be the ultimate user I/O device.  If he actually builds a Wii controller with the brains of an iPhone it will be an incredible thing to watch in action.  He will and should be proud if/when this thing is actually produced.

    Adobe has said it's willing to offer Flash for the iPhone, but says it would need access beyond that of the official SDK, which bars plug-ins.

    I believe Apple will buy Adobe before it lets this stop them.
